Historically, the full-scale Smith Miniplane is one of the designs that helped start the modern homebuilding era. Originally designed and built in 1957 by Frank Smith of Fullerton, California, the Miniplane was an early example of engineering with the amateur homebuilder and weekend pilot in mind. It could be constructed with tools easily within reach of the average craftsman, and in the air it was stable and easy to fly. The top wing spanned 17 ft., and the empty weight was a mere 600 pounds. Powered by a 100hp Lycoming, the tiny Miniplane cruised at 120 mph, climbed at a fantastic 2,500 ft. per minute, and was highly aerobatic. It was just what many sportsman pilots were looking for!
R/C Sport Scale BiPlane
In 1974, Glen Sigafoose, then President of Sig Mfg. Co., acquired a complete Smith Miniplane to use for aerobatic practice. Glen's beautiful red, white, and black aircraft was the inspiration for this mini version of the Miniplane.

All AA size cells over 1700mAh should not be fast charged ever! If you repeat this experiment, your on your own. I recommend only factory wall wart charging with units rated of 70mAh or less for these type cells.
Break in (first forming charge) on 50mAh factory wall charger 700mAh-19.6 hours,1100-30.8 hours,1650-46.2 hours, 2500-70 hours. For 70mAh wall charger deduct 28% of time, for 100mAh wall charger deduct 50% of time. Forming charge (initial charge) on peak detection chargers is not recommended and voids warranty.

Sodium-ion batteries are highly safe, have no risk of explosion and fire, and are environmentally friendly, non-toxic and non-polluting. No memory effect - the battery can be charged in any state of discharge, giving you peace of mind. The working principle of sodium ion batteries is similar to that of lithium-ion batteries, which utilize the insertion and removal process of sodium ions between the positive and negative electrodes to achieve charging and discharging. Advantage of Sodium ion Battery
1. Long cycle life: The cycle is longer, compared with Lithium ion battery, can reach to 4000-4500 times.
2. Safety: Sodium-ion cells can be discharged to 0V for transport, avoiding thermal run-away hazards.
3. High Power: The cells have continuous discharge current 10C Peak discharge current.
4. Low temperature: Can be used in low temperature environments, with a discharge capacity of up to 85% at a temperature of -30 degrees.
5. Wild Voltage range: The working voltage range is 1.5V-4.1V.
6. Environmental abundance: Sodium is over 1000 times more abundant than lithium and more evenly distributed worldwide. So its price is more stable.
7. LOWER COST: Sodium precursors (such as Na2CO3) are far cheaper than the equivalent lithium compounds.
